Once on the water, the guided kayak tour takes you through the crystal-clear waters of Willow Beach. The main highlight is paddling into Black Canyon, where the Emerald Cave awaits as the central attraction. When sunlight hits just right, the water inside the cave shines with vibrant shades of green, creating a captivating photo opportunity.
Guides like Blair and EJ lead the group with attentiveness and expertise, explaining the area’s features, the local wildlife—including eagles, herons, and big horn sheep—and safety tips. The water temperature at the Black Canyon remains refreshingly cool, at around 52-54 degrees, providing excellent spots for swimming and cooling off.
The scenery along this route is a significant part of the tour’s appeal. The breathtaking views of the river winding through the rugged canyon walls make every paddle stroke worthwhile. The guides’ detailed commentary enhances the experience, sharing insights about the natural landscape and the history of the area.
Wildlife spotting is common during the trip, with bald eagles often seen soaring overhead, along with desert big horn sheep and various waterfowl. The tranquil environment and peaceful waters make this trip feel like a true getaway into nature.
The Emerald Cave delivers a rewarding destination after about an hour of paddling. Once there, groups often take swimming breaks in the cool water, with the guide providing safety and encouragement. This is a chance to relax, cool off, and enjoy the stunning natural beauty of the cave.

Participants should have a moderate physical fitness level. The activity involves paddling for about 3.5 hours, with opportunities for swimming and walking to and from the kayaks. The tour is suitable for those comfortable with upper-body movement, and children aged 8 and above are welcome.
For guests over 275 pounds, it is recommended to contact the supplier directly at +17029352925 for accommodation. The tour is not handicap accessible due to the nature of kayaking and the need for upper-body mobility.

Reservations are best made around 31 days in advance for optimal availability. The tour features free cancellation, allowing full refunds if canceled at least 24 hours before the scheduled start. Weather conditions are a factor, and if poor weather causes cancellation, clients are offered alternative dates or a full refund.
